package org.apache.storm.command;
import com.google.common.base.Preconditions;
import java.util.HashMap;
import java.util.Map;
import org.apache.logging.log4j.Level;
import org.apache.storm.generated.LogConfig;
import org.apache.storm.generated.LogLevel;
import org.apache.storm.generated.LogLevelAction;
import org.apache.storm.generated.Nimbus;
import org.apache.storm.utils.NimbusClient;
import org.apache.storm.utils.Utils;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
public class SetLogLevel {
private static final Logger LOG = LoggerFactory.getLogger(SetLogLevel.class);
public static void main(String[] args) throws Exception {
Map<String, Object> cl = CLI.opt("l", "log-setting", null, new LogLevelsParser(LogLevelAction.UPDATE), CLI.INTO_MAP)
.opt("r", "remove-log-setting", null, new LogLevelsParser(LogLevelAction.REMOVE), CLI.INTO_MAP)
.arg("topologyName", CLI.FIRST_WINS)
.parse(args);
final String topologyName = (String) cl.get("topologyName");
final LogConfig logConfig = new LogConfig();
Map<String, LogLevel> logLevelMap = new HashMap<>();
Map<String, LogLevel> updateLogLevel = (Map<String, LogLevel>) cl.get("l");
if (null != updateLogLevel) {
logLevelMap.putAll(updateLogLevel);
}
Map<String, LogLevel> removeLogLevel = (Map<String, LogLevel>) cl.get("r");
if (null != removeLogLevel) {
logLevelMap.putAll(removeLogLevel);
}
for (Map.Entry<String, LogLevel> entry : logLevelMap.entrySet()) {
logConfig.put_to_named_logger_level(entry.getKey(), entry.getValue());
}
NimbusClient.withConfiguredClient(new NimbusClient.WithNimbus() {
@Override
public void run(Nimbus.Iface nimbus) throws Exception {
String topologyId = Utils.getTopologyId(topologyName, nimbus);
if (null == topologyId) {
throw new IllegalArgumentException(topologyName + " is not a running topology");
}
nimbus.setLogConfig(topologyId, logConfig);
LOG.info("Log config {} is sent for topology {}", logConfig, topologyName);
}
});
}
/**
* Parses [logger name]=[level string]:[optional timeout],[logger name2]...
* e.g. ROOT=DEBUG:30
* root logger, debug for 30 seconds
* org.apache.foo=WARN
* org.apache.foo set to WARN indefinitely
*/
static final class LogLevelsParser implements CLI.Parse {
private LogLevelAction action;
LogLevelsParser(LogLevelAction action) {
this.action = action;
}
@Override
public Object parse(String value) {
final LogLevel logLevel = new LogLevel();
logLevel.set_action(action);
String name = null;
if (action == LogLevelAction.REMOVE) {
name = value;
} else {
String[] splits = value.split("=");
Preconditions.checkArgument(splits.length == 2, "Invalid log string '%s'", value);
name = splits[0];
splits = splits[1].split(":");
Integer timeout = 0;
Level level = Level.valueOf(splits[0]);
logLevel.set_target_log_level(level.toString());
if (splits.length > 1) {
timeout = Integer.parseInt(splits[1]);
}
logLevel.set_reset_log_level_timeout_secs(timeout);
}
Map<String, LogLevel> result = new HashMap<>();
result.put(name, logLevel);
return result;
}
}
}
